Output 62bcfde3db0782f3d9220603df511e475dbcbe1bc02f789e61fedb2526706136:1

value
90113170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ed4e4420bab1d8d01980983c67adc487692eea23 OP_EQUAL
address
3PKmq2t1i1ybsmLNGQYN2YyDoDCFAghAwR
transaction
62bcfde3db0782f3d9220603df511e475dbcbe1bc02f789e61fedb2526706136
confirmations
236145
spent
true